Image IPB NRL Tipping Competition Round 22 Results

Roosters 26 - 10 Dragons Home Win (No team score of 9 or less)
Storm 46 - 6 Panthers Home Win (1 team score of 9 or less)
Knights 10 - 26 Bulldogs Away Win (No team score of 9 or less)
Cowboys 6 - 8 Sea Eagles Away Win (2 teams score 9 or less)
Warriors 4 - 45 Sharks Away Win (1 team score of 9 or less)
Raiders 28 - 12 Broncos Home Win (No team score of 9 or less)
Titans 18 - 22 Rabbitohs Away Win (No team score of 9 or less)
Tigers 51 -26 Eels Home Win (No team score of 9 or less)

NRL Round 21 Summary
Winners: Roosters, Storm, Bulldogs, Sea Eagles, Sharks, Raiders, Rabbitohs and Tigers
4 Away Wins
Points total: 344
Poll: Number of teams scoring only 9 points or less 4 - Panthers Cowboys, Sea Eagles and Warriors
